What does an analytical method development scientist do?

An Analytical Method Development Scientist is responsible for designing, developing, and validating analytical methods used to test and analyze chemical compounds, pharmaceuticals, or other materials. They ensure that the methods are accurate, reliable, and compliant with regulatory standards. This role involves working with advanced laboratory instruments, troubleshooting analytical issues, and documenting procedures for use in research, quality control, or manufacturing environments.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an analytical method development scientist?

To thrive as an Analytical Method Development Scientist, a strong background in chemistry, analytical techniques, and method validation—often supported by a relevant degree in chemistry or pharmaceutical sciences—is essential. Familiarity with laboratory instrumentation such as HPLC, GC, MS, and software for data analysis, as well as knowledge of regulatory guidelines like ICH and FDA, is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ication are vital soft skills for success in this role. These skills ensure reliable method development, regulatory compliance, and effective collaboration within multidisciplinary scientific teams.

What are the typical challenges faced by an analytical method development scientist when transferring methods to quality control or manufacturing teams?

One common challenge for Analytical Method Development Scientists is ensuring that newly developed analytical methods are robust and reproducible when transferred to quality control or manufacturing teams. Differences in equipment, sample matrices, or operator technique can impact results, so thorough method validation and clear documentation are essential. Scientists often work closely with cross-functional teams to provide training, troubleshoot issues, and adapt protocols as needed. Successfully managing these transitions helps maintain product quality and regulatory compliance.

What is the difference between Analytical Method Development Scientist vs Analytical Chemist?

AspectAnalytical Method Development ScientistAnalytical Chemist
Primary FocusDeveloping and validating new analytical methodsPerforming routine analysis and testing
Work EnvironmentResearch labs, R&D departmentsQuality control labs, manufacturing facilities
CredentialsBachelor's or Master's in Chemistry or related field; experience in method developmentBachelor's degree in Chemistry or related field; experience in analytical testing

While both roles involve analytical testing, the Analytical Method Development Scientist primarily focuses on creating and validating new analytical methods, often in research settings. In contrast, the Analytical Chemist typically performs routine testing to ensure product quality in manufacturing or quality control labs.

Booz Allen Hamilton is a leading provider of management and technology consulting services to the US government in defense, intelligence, and civil markets. Headquartered in McLean, Virginia, the firm also serves major corporations, institutions, and not-for-profit organizations. Founded in 1914 by Edwin G. Booz, the company has a long-standing tradition of helping clients achieve success by delivering a wide range of consulting services that include strategic planning, human capital and learning, communication, systems development, and others. The company's mission is to empower people to change the world, and it has a reputation for maintaining the highest standards of integrity and-excellence.
